1 2 3 4 5 6 7 8 9 10 11 12 13 14 Pursuant to Defendant, Kenneth Foster's Third Motion to Continue the Sentencing, Government 15 having no objection, and good cause appearing, to wit: counsel in trial in Superior Court, IT IS ORDERED granting Defendant's Motion to Continue Sentencing. The Court specifically finds 16 17 that the ends of justice served by granting a continuance outweighs the best interests of the public and the 18 Defendant. This finding is based upon the Court's conclusion that the failure to grant such a continuance 19 would deny the Defendant the reasonable time necessary for effective preparation for sentencing. IT IS FURTHER ORDERED continuing Sentencing from March 20, 2006 to April 17, 2006 at 10:30 20 21 a.m. This is the last continuance that will be granted absent extraordinary circumstances.
